The Greater Noida plant will be an international food park that will cater to overseas and domestic markets as well.

The food park in Greater Noida is slated to manufacture all major products. It is expected to act as a hub given its location in the
The plant, at full capacity, will produce goods worth Rs 25,000 crore annually. It is expected to generate around 10,000 direct jobs that can benefit nearly 50,000 families.
